Strong's #3565: kuwr (pronounced koor)

from 3564 and 6227; furnace of smoke; Cor-Ashan, a place in Palestine:--Chor-ashan.




Brown-Driver-Briggs Hebrew Lexicon:

ּ ׁ

kôr ‛âshân

Chor-ashan = "furnace of smoke"

1) a town in Judah

Part of Speech: noun proper locative

Relation: from H3564 and H6227



Usage:

This word is used 1 times:

1 Samuel 30:30: "And to them which were in Hormah, and to them which were in Chor-ashan, and to them which were in Athach,"
